Design of PCI Bus High-Speed Data Acquisition System Based on FPGA
Peripheral component interconnect (PCI) bus is a standard bus of the computer. It adopts European standard and has the advantages of plug and play, interrupt sharing, high-speed transmission, and safety fastening. However, the PCI communication protocol is complex and difficult to develop. This article uses the PCI9054 protocol conversion chip to build a bridge between the upper computer and the lower computer. The data acquisition card uses AD7606 to complete the conversion between analog signal and digital signal. The field programmable gate array (FPGA) controls the acquisition of AD data and the data transfer between the AD7606 and PCI9054. PLX provides API functions for the PCI protocol on the computer side. Based on these functions, the data acquisition and display program are written in the VC++ 6.0 environment, and then the program is packaged as a dynamic link library. The dynamic link library is called by LabVIEW, and the data display and storage are done in LabVIEW. The experimental results show that the scheme works stably, the transmission speed is fast, and the data is accurate.
- Record URL:
-
Availability:
- Find a library where document is available. Order URL: http://worldcat.org/isbn/9789811529146
-
Supplemental Notes:
- © Springer Nature Singapore Pte Ltd. 2020.
-
Corporate Authors:
Springer Singapore
152 Beach Road
Singapore, 189721 -
Authors:
- Zhu, Xiaoming
- Wang, Xiaodong
- Chen, Jie
- Qiu, Ruichang
- Liu, Zhigang
-
Conference:
- 4th International Conference on Electrical and Information Technologies for Rail Transportation (EITRT 2019)
- Location: Qingdao , China
- Date: 2019-10-25 to 2019-10-27
- Publication Date: 2020-4
Language
- English
Media Info
- Media Type: Web
- Features: References;
- Pagination: pp 61-69
- Monograph Title: Proceedings of the 4th International Conference on Electrical and Information Technologies for Rail Transportation (EITRT) 2019: Rail Transportation Information Processing and Operational Management Technologies
-
Serial:
- Lecture Notes in Electrical Engineering
- Publisher: Springer
- ISSN: 1876-1100
Subject/Index Terms
- TRT Terms: Buses (Electricity); Data communications; Data displays; Electric circuits; Integrated circuits
- Identifier Terms: LabVIEW (Computer program)
- Subject Areas: Data and Information Technology; Railroads; Transportation (General); Vehicles and Equipment;
Filing Info
- Accession Number: 01928524
- Record Type: Publication
- ISBN: 9789811529146
- Files: TRIS
- Created Date: Aug 23 2024 4:53PM